The Wolves of Peachtree Corners competitive cheer program is on a winning streak, having scored its third consecutive National and Grand Championship with the Fellowship of Christian Cheerleaders (FCC) competition recently held in Orlando, FL.
The Wolves, a parent-organized cheerleading club comprised of athletes who all attend Wesleyan School in Peachtree Corners, is quickly earning a reputation in the competitive cheerleading world.
It seems the girls on the GOLD and WHITE teams are unstoppable, both having won their divisions at all regional competitions this season and National Championships and Grand Championships at FCC Nationals.
According to Powell, parents at Wesleyan decided to connect with FCC only three years ago seeking a competitive outlet for their girls that aligned with the Christian mission of their school.
“It’s been wildly successful,” Powell said. “All three years, the Gold team has won National and State championships, which was a huge feat for a new program.”
